I have listed a car on eBay for sale, and having revised the item today, I have noticed a secondary contact number has been added which is nothing to do with me, someone I know has text the number and had a reply stating the car is sold, but I tried ringing the number and it doesn't connect

this is the second time as it also happened a few months ago

has anyone else come accross this when they have sold a car on eBay? and could it be possible that a bot is generating money from people calling what they think is my contact number? I have deleted the number off my ad and will persistantly check it to make sure it doesn't happen again, and I have emailed eBay but if i'm honest I don't trust their reply anyway as I suspect it could also be a canvasser with some kind of agreement with eBay..

yeh i've done that, did it last time, and once before when I was suddenly selling over a hundred designer handbags that I didn't have lol, one thing I can't stand at the moment is internet security....

you may want to completely wipe your PC and reinstall the operating system. If you are changing your password and people are still getting in I can only assume your machine is redirecting you to a fake eBay login or you have a key stroke logger installed etc.
